一般描述
双酚A(BPA)是二苯基甲烷衍生物,含有2个羟苯基。独特的化学结构给材料带来优异的热稳定性和力学强度。可作为关键单体制备聚碳酸酯塑料和环氧树脂。BPA可提高这些产物的耐用性、抗冲击性和透明度,适于汽车、电子和建筑行业使用。
